This Saturday night, Aisling Bea, Donal Skehan and Peter Stringer will appear on the series finale of Angela Scanlon's Ask Me Anything.
Bafta-winning comedy writer and actress Aisling Bea chats to Angela about Twitter's reaction to her English accent in Home Sweet Home Alone, why women wonder about being held back and why men are paid more than them and if she was a superhero she'd be 'Horse Woman'.

Food writer and cook Donal Skehan lifts the lid on dying his hair since he was 23, how he managed to offend the entire Italian population, his friendship with Brian Dowling since their Peter Pan panto days and his favourite Swedish chocolate Plopp.

And rugby legend Peter Stringer tells Angela how he was bullied about his height as a kid and refused to take growth hormones, how he eats lots of fibre to "stay regular" and his awkward encounter with Lady Gaga and his wife.
